Question

I'm trying to find the best possible case to protect my Ice Visor Deluxe yet also fit in my suit pocket without being too bulky. Any suggestions?

Thanks in advance for your help!

I carry my Visor in my suit pocket with just the protective plastic cover that comes with it. It fits fine and protects the screen enough for me.

I recommend the Rhodiana case. http://www.rhodiana.com

A quality case with nice padding, but without adding much bulk.
If it is for your suit pocket, do not get the belt clip option as it adds a prong to the back.

HS slim leather is what I use. You couldn't have a smaller leather case for the HS. Tuck a few business cards in there and you are ready to go.

I use the leather slip case that came with my BVD. It's not much for protection, but in a suit pocket I figure I don't really need much protection.

E&B Slipper... nice case, good screen protection, acceptable "professional" looks...
